小孩应该学什么编程
-
小孩应该学习什么编程?
编程是现代社会中一项非常重要的技能,它不仅可以帮助孩子们培养解决问题的能力,还可以提高逻辑思维和创造力。因此,小孩们学习编程可以从以下几个方面着手。
首先,小孩应该学习基本的编程概念和原理。这包括学习编程语言的基本语法、变量、循环、条件语句等基本概念。例如,学习使用Scratch这样的可视化编程语言可以帮助小孩更容易理解编程的基本概念。
其次,小孩应该学习如何使用编程来解决实际问题。例如,他们可以学习如何编写一个简单的计算器程序,编写一个自动化的水果打包机器等。这种学习的方式可以帮助小孩将编程与实际生活场景相结合,提高他们的问题解决能力。
另外,小孩还可以学习一些与编程相关的技术和工具。例如,他们可以学习使用HTML和CSS来设计和构建网页,学习使用Python来进行数据分析等。这些技术和工具在现实生活和职业发展中具有广泛的应用,对小孩的未来发展非常有帮助。
此外,小孩还可以通过参加编程比赛和项目来提高自己的编程水平。例如,他们可以参加国内外的编程比赛,结识更多的同龄人,增加自己的编程经验和技能。同时,他们也可以参加一些编程项目,与其他小孩一起合作完成一个小型的编程项目,锻炼自己的合作能力和创造力。
总的来说,小孩学习编程对于他们的成长和发展非常重要。通过学习编程,他们可以培养解决问题的能力,提高逻辑思维和创造力,并为将来的职业发展打下坚实的基础。
1年前 -
编程作为一种思维方式,已经成为当下教育领域的热门话题。越来越多的父母开始意识到让孩子学习编程的重要性。那么,小孩应该学什么样的编程呢?下面是几个建议。
-
开发创造力
编程可以帮助孩子培养创造力。通过编程,孩子们可以学习设计游戏、创造自己的动画、制作音乐等,这些活动都需要创造力来完成。通过编程,孩子们可以把自己的想法转化为实际产品,培养他们的创造力和想象力。 -
培养解决问题的能力
编程是一种解决问题的能力。通过编程,孩子们可以学习如何分析和解决问题,培养他们的逻辑思维和问题解决能力。编程涉及到分析问题、找到解决方案并实现,这个过程可以帮助孩子们锻炼思考和解决问题的能力。 -
学习数学和科学概念
编程是一门需要数学和科学知识作为基础的学科。通过编程,孩子们可以学习数学概念,如变量、函数、循环等,也可以学习科学概念,如物理、化学等。通过编程,孩子们可以将抽象的数学和科学概念与实际场景联系起来,提高他们的学习效率和兴趣。 -
培养团队合作精神
编程可以帮助孩子们培养团队合作精神。在编程过程中,孩子们经常需要与他人合作,共同解决问题。通过与他人合作,孩子们可以学习如何有效地沟通、协调和分工合作,培养团队合作精神和社交能力。 -
学习如何管理项目
编程需要管理项目的能力。在编程过程中,孩子们需要学习如何制定计划、分配任务、跟踪进度和调整计划。通过编程,孩子们可以学习如何管理自己的项目,并培养项目管理的能力。
综上所述,小孩学习编程可以开发创造力、培养解决问题的能力、学习数学和科学概念、培养团队合作精神以及学习如何管理项目等。这些都是与孩子未来发展息息相关的重要技能。让孩子学习编程不仅能够培养其创造力和解决问题的能力,还可以帮助他们在数字化时代中更好地适应和发展。
1年前 -
-
小孩学习编程可以从以下几个方面考虑:
-
学习计算思维:计算思维是通过分析问题、抽象问题、解决问题的一种思维方式。编程是锻炼计算思维的非常有效的方法之一。通过学习编程,孩子可以培养自己的逻辑思维能力、问题分析能力和解决问题的能力。
-
学习创造力:编程是一种创造性的活动,通过编写代码,孩子可以构建出自己的作品,如游戏、动画等。这些作品的创作过程可以激发孩子的创造力和想象力,帮助他们培养创造新事物的能力。
-
培养解决问题的能力:通过编程,孩子需要面对各种问题和挑战,如调试代码、解决bug等。在解决这些问题的过程中,他们可以学会分析问题、找出问题的根源,并采取相应的措施来解决问题。
-
增强数学能力:编程与数学有着紧密的联系,通过编程,孩子可以更好地理解数学概念和原理,并将其应用于实际问题中。例如,通过编写一个计算器程序,孩子可以加深对数学运算的理解。
-
增加社交能力:编程也可以成为孩子与他人合作、交流和分享的途径。通过参与编程社区、参加编程比赛等活动,孩子可以与其他编程爱好者交流经验、互相学习,并且展示自己的作品,从中得到认可和鼓励。
对于小孩学习编程的具体内容,可以根据孩子的年龄和兴趣进行选择。以下是一些常见的编程学习内容:
-
图形化编程语言:对于较小的孩子,可以使用图形化编程语言如Scratch、Blockly等进行学习。这些语言通常通过拖拽积木块来组合代码,让孩子可以轻松地编写程序,并且能够看到实时结果。
-
编程概念:对于稍大一些的孩子,可以学习一些基本的编程概念,如变量、循环、条件语句等。可以使用编程语言如Python、JavaScript等进行学习,这些语言简单易学,并且有丰富的学习资源。
-
游戏开发:游戏开发是小孩学习编程的一个很好的方式。他们可以使用游戏引擎如Unity、Unreal Engine等进行学习,构建自己的游戏,并学习一些高级编程概念和技术,如物理引擎、碰撞检测等。
-
Web开发:对于对网页设计感兴趣的孩子,可以学习Web开发。他们可以学习HTML、CSS和JavaScript等技术,创建自己的网页,并学习如何与用户进行交互。
-
机器人编程:机器人编程是一种将编程与物理世界结合起来的学习方式。通过编写代码控制机器人的运动和行为,孩子可以学习到如何编程控制物体,并理解编程对现实世界的应用。
总的来说,孩子学习编程应该从培养计算思维、创造力和解决问题能力的角度出发,选择适合孩子年龄和兴趣的编程内容进行学习。同时,家长可以提供一定的指导和支持,鼓励孩子在编程学习中发展自己的兴趣和才能。
1年前 -